In exercise of the powers conferred by clause (1) of article 222 of the Constitution of India, the President, after consultation with the Chief Justice of India, is pleased to transfer Shri Justice Suresh Kumar Kait, Judge of the Delhi High Court, as a Judge of the High Court of Judicature at Hyderabad for the States of Telangana and Andhra Pradesh and to direct him to assume charge of his office in the High Court of Judicature at Hyderabad for the States of Telangana and Andhra Pradesh on or before 15th April, 2016.

In exercise of the powers conferred by clause (1) of article 222 of the Constitution of India, the President, after consultation with the Chief Justice of India, is pleased to transfer Shri Justice Rajiv Shakdher, Judge of the Delhi High Court, as a Judge of the Madras High Court and to direct him to assume charge of his office in the Madras High Court on or before 15th April, 2016.

In exercise of the powers conferred by clause (1) of article 222 of the Constitution of India, the President, after consultation with the Chief Justice of India, is pleased to transfer Shri Justice Kaushal Jayendra Thaker, Additional Judge of the Gujarat High Court, as an Additional Judge of the Allahabad High Court and to direct him to assume charge of his office in the Allahabad High Court on or before 15th April, 2016.
